I have about a good 50ft of wire laying around that is used to go from a power pole to your house for the meter box on your house what im wanting to know is if it would be ok to use on a car for the big 3 and running to your amps. or would it just be better to get some 1/0 wire What hardware will you be running ?? In general though, get some decent 1/0, higher strand count is better. That "power pole" wire is good for powering your home but for car audio the high strand 1/0 has more surface area (increased current potential) and you can find some very flexable stuff to make wire nvigation in your car simpler.
